Overall Meaning

The first verse of the song "CS" by Lil Uzi Vert talks about being in a situation where all the various paths in life converge into one, leaving you no choice but to move forward. The repetition of "when the roads all merge into one" emphasizes the feeling of being trapped or forced into a particular direction. The line "You're forced to drive, ah" further emphasizes this sense of being pushed forward without having much control over the situation.


The chorus of the song delves into themes of self-expression and the pressure to conform. It starts with the phrase "wake up," which can be interpreted as a call to action or realization. The lyrics "grab a brush and put a little makeup" can be seen as a metaphorical instruction to hide one's flaws or scars, pretending to be someone else in order to fit in or appease others. This can be a response to societal pressure or the desire to mask one's true emotions.


The line "hide the scars to fade away the shake-up" suggests the act of suppressing past wounds or traumas in order to move on and avoid disturbances or disruptions in life. The repetition of "why'd you leave the keys up on the table?" can be interpreted as a question directed towards oneself, wondering why they have allowed others to take control and dictate their actions or choices.


The second verse echoes similar themes as the first verse and chorus. There is a sense of frustration and a plea for understanding and trust. The mention of "self-righteous suicide" can be interpreted as a desire to assert one's own autonomy and individuality, even if it means going against societal expectations or norms. The repeated line "and I cry when angels deserve to die" expresses the frustration of seeing positive or deserving things being overlooked or ignored.


Overall, the lyrics of "CS" by Lil Uzi Vert touch on themes of conformity, societal pressure, the desire for self-expression, and the frustration that comes with feeling misunderstood or undervalued. The repetition of certain phrases throughout the song highlights the emotions and struggles that arise from these themes, creating a strong impact on the listener.
